Abstract

A composite formulation for use in lightweight molded components includes an untreated low density filler, such as glass bubbles, a solvated polymer mixture, and polymer paste. In one embodiment the solvated polymer mixture is used to treat the low density filler to form a treated low density filler. The solvated polymer mixture many include a thermoplastic resin or a reactive resin and an additive package. The additive package may include a dispersing agent and a silane carrier composition.

Claims (33)

1. A composite formulation for use in lightweight molded components, wherein the composite formulation comprises

a treated low density filler comprising

an untreated low density filler and

a solvated polymer mixture, wherein the solvated polymer mixture comprises a thermoplastic resin or a reactive resin and an additive package, the additive package comprising a dispersing agent;

wherein the solvated polymer mixture is present in an amount of about 0.5% to about 20% by weight based on the weight of the untreated low density filler; and

wherein the solvated polymer mixture is combined with about 80% to about 99.5% by weight of the untreated low density filler to form the treated low density filler.

2. The composite formulation of claim 1 , wherein the additive package further comprises a silane carrier composition.

3. The composite formulation of claim 1 , wherein the composite formulation further comprises a polymer paste.

4. The composite formulation of claim 1 , wherein the solvated polymer mixture comprises about 20% to about 97% by weight of the additive package and about 3% to about 80% by weight of the thermoplastic resin or a reactive resin.

5. The composite formulation of claim 4 , wherein the solvated polymer mixture comprises about 60% by weight of the additive package and about 40% by weight of the thermoplastic resin or reactive resin.

6. A composite formulation for use in lightweight molded components, wherein the composite formulation comprises:

an untreated low density filler;

a solvated polymer mixture, wherein the solvated polymer mixture comprises a thermoplastic resin or a reactive resin and an additive package, the additive package comprising a dispersing agent and a silane carrier composition;

wherein the solvated polymer mixture is present in an amount of about 0.5% to about 20% by weight based on the weight of the untreated low density filler; and

wherein the additive package comprises about 68% to about 96% by weight of the dispersing agent and from about 4% to about 32% by weight of the silane carrier composition.

7. The composite formulation of claim 6 , wherein the additive package comprises about 85% by weight of the dispersing agent and about 15% by weight of the silane carrier composition.

8. The composite formulation of claim 3 , wherein the polymer paste comprises a low density sheet molded compound, a bulk molding compound, a pultrusion compound, or a cast polymer compound.

9. The composite formulation of claim 1 , wherein the dispersing agent is an alkyl amine-based or fluorocarbon-based polymer.

10. The composite formulation of claim 1 , wherein the untreated low density filler comprises hollow spheres.

11. A treated low density filler for use in lightweight molded components, wherein the treated low density filler comprises:

an untreated low density filler;

from about 0.5% to about 20% by weight of a solvated polymer mixture based on the weight of the untreated low density filler, wherein the solvated polymer mixture comprises a thermoplastic resin or a reactive resin and an additive package, the additive package including a dispersing agent and optionally, a silane carrier composition; and

wherein the solvated polymer mixture is combined with about 80% to about 99.5% by weight of the untreated low density filler to form the treated low density filler.

12. The treated low density filler of claim 11 , wherein the solvated polymer mixture comprises about 20% to about 97% by weight of the additive package and about 3% to about 80% by weight of the thermoplastic resin or a reactive resin.

13. The treated low density filler of claim 12 , wherein the solvated polymer mixture comprises about 60% by weight of the additive package and about 40% by weight of the thermoplastic resin or reactive resin.

14. A treated low density filler for use in lightweight molded components, wherein the treated low density filler comprises:

an untreated low density filler;

from about 0.5% to about 20% by weight of a solvated polymer mixture based on the weight of the untreated low density filler, wherein the solvated polymer mixture comprises a thermoplastic resin or a reactive resin and an additive package, the additive package including a dispersing agent and a silane carrier composition;

wherein the solvated polymer mixture is combined with about 80% to about 99.5% by weight of the untreated low density filler to form the treated low density filler; and

wherein the additive package comprises about 68% to about 96% by weight of the dispersing agent and from about 4% to about 32% by weight of the silane carrier composition.

15. The treated low density filler of claim 14 , wherein the additive package comprises about 85% by weight of the dispersing agent and about 15% by weight of the silane carrier composition.

16. The treated low density filler of claim 11 , wherein the untreated low density filler comprises hollow spheres.

17. The treated low density filler of claim 11 , wherein the dispersing agent is an alkyl amine-based or a fluorocarbon-based polymer.
